Clarke R. Starnes III is a highly experienced financial executive and corporate director, recently joining the boards of Western Alliance Bank and the ProSight Financial Association. He retired as Vice Chair and Chief Risk Officer of Truist, where he was the longest-tenured CRO among the top 25 U.S. banks. He is a graduate of UNC Chapel Hill.
